Insurance United Against Dementia (IUAD) has added Tracy-Lee Kus, chief executive at Aon’s Global Broking Centre, to its board of industry leaders.

Kus brings over 30 years of experience in both underwriting and broking, alongside being a leader of diversity and inclusion in the industry.

As a new board member, Kus will support the IUAD in its new goal to reach £20m by 2030 as it looks to accelerate progress towards a world where dementia no longer devastates lives.

Kus said: “I am most excited about the opportunity to help mobilise our industry – bringing together insurers, brokers and partners to fund research, support carers and use our collective influence for meaningful impact.

”Dementia is no longer an abstract future risk, there are almost a million people living with the disease in the UK and it has become the UK’s leading cause of death. I am looking forward to being able to contribute my experience, networks and energy to a campaign that moves beyond awareness and delivers tangible support and progress.”

Close to home 

Kus also holds a personal connection to the cause as she revealed that her mother lives with dementia. 

“Watching someone you love change in ways you cannot stop is both heartbreaking and humbling,” she continued.

“Joining the board is, for me, a way to turn something deeply personal into something purposeful whilst also contributing my experience, networks and energy to a campaign that moves beyond awareness and delivers tangible support and progress.”
